The Objective of Probate Bonds
Probate bonds function as a crucial monetary defense system for executors and administrators managing the distribution of an estate. As an administrator or administrator, you have the responsibility to take care of the properties and financial debts of the deceased person's estate. The probate bond, likewise called an administrator bond or fiduciary bond, makes sure that you meet your obligations morally and legally.
By needing a probate bond, the court aims to secure the estate from any prospective mismanagement or transgression on your component. If you, as the administrator or manager, act dishonestly or negligently, the bond offers a type of insurance coverage to compensate the beneficiaries of the estate for any type of economic losses incurred. This protection is important in cases where the administrator makes mistakes in managing the estate's assets or fails to adhere to the legal needs of the probate procedure.
Ultimately, probate bonds supply peace of mind to the beneficiaries of the estate, as they offer a layer of financial security versus the risks associated with estate management.
